Portability and Setup Process

Portability is a major benefit since parts collapse and fit into a dedicated carry case. First, unpack the case and extend the frame. Next, snap the countertop into place and apply the graphic wrap as needed. The full setup often takes less than ten minutes for a single person. Finally, when the show ends, the components store compactly, which reduces storage needs and lowers transit complexity.

Use Cases and Positioning Strategies

Place the WaveLine® InfoDesk near the booth entrance to greet visitors, or alternatively position it along a traffic aisle to capture passersby. For demonstrations, orient the counter with the back to staff workstations so materials remain accessible. Moreover, use multiple desks to create information points across larger booths, which decreases congestion and increases one-on-one interactions. For sponsorships or co-branded events, the counters function as registration stations or branded meet-and-greet points, boosting both visibility and lead capture.
